The LSU Tigers got a massive transfer quarterback on Sunday.
Brian Kelly was able to pull former Arizona State quarterback Jayden Daniels from the portal and he very wll could start next season.
Daniels has been the starter for the last three seasons at Arizona State and brings a wealth of experience to the locker room as well.
ESPN’s Paul Finebaum thinks that this move could be Kelly’s version of what Ed Orgeron got in Joe Burrow when he transferred to Baton Rouge.
“I think it is a very big story,” Finebaum said on WJOX out of Alabama. “Is this going to be a transformational moment for Brian Kelly? This guy is a really good quarterback. You guys all know that. But is that all they need? Joe Burrow played two years there and he also had a cast around him that was spectacular. I don’t think LSU does. But I think it was smart. I think Brian Kelly probably doesn’t know what he has, but this guy is probably better than everyone who has migrated.”
Daniels had a bit of a down year this year with 10 touchdowns and 10 interceptions off of 2,380 yards passing.
That said, he was outstanding in 2019 when he threw for 2,943 yards, plus had 17 touchdowns and two interceptions.
With spring practice right around the corner, Daniels will have his first shot to win the starting job.
